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ill Yes No You can likely handle a small water spill on your own.
Large water spill or flood No Yes A large water spill or flood need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Visible water damage on carpet or flooring No Yes Visible water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and mold growth.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Musty odors or mold growth need professional attention to remove and prevent further growth.
Water damage to underlying flooring No Yes Water damage to underlying flooring need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Insurance claim No Yes Our team can help you navigate the insurance claims process and ensure you receive the coverage you deserve.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Gravette, AR

The cost of carpet water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Gravette, AR.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. Here are some estimated costs for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Disinfecting and deodoriz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Carpet repl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of carpet
Underlayment replacement $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of underlayment
Insurance claims help $0 – $500 Severity of damage, complexity of claim
Emergency services (after hours) $100 – $500 Severity of damage, time of day

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a free estimate from our team. We’re happy to provide a quote for your specific needs.
